Our Mission

The ABPI exists to make the UK the best place in the world to research, develop and access medicines and vaccines to improve patient care.

We represent companies of all sizes which invest in making and discovering medicines and vaccines to enhance and save the lives of millions of people around the world.

In England, Scotland, Wales and Northern Ireland, we work in partnership with governments and the NHS so that patients can get new treatments faster and the NHS can plan how much it spends on medicines. Every day, our members partner with healthcare professionals, academics and patient organisations to find new solutions to unmet health needs.

Our strategy

Medicines and vaccines are transforming our lives like never before. We want the UK to be the best place in the world to research, develop and use the medicines and vaccines of the future. To do this, we focus on:

  • Improving access to new medicines and vaccines so everyone in the UK can get the latest treatments.
  • Building a thriving environment for medicine discovery so the UK can be the best place in the world to research and develop new medicines and vaccines.
  • Enhancing reputation by demonstrating the high ethical standards we set ourselves and that society expects from us.
  • Working in partnership with Government, the NHS and the life science community
  • Providing UK leadership to drive global medicines policy.
  • Improving how health data can transform medicine development and improve patient care
  • Representing our members, using their insight and experience to tell the story of how they change the lives of millions of people every day.

Prescription Medicines Code of Practice Authority (PMCPA)

The Prescription Medicines Code of Practice Authority (PMCPA) was established by The Association of the British Pharmaceutical Industry to operate the ABPI Code of Practice for the Pharmaceutical Industry independently of the ABPI.

The PMCPA is a division of the ABPI which is a company limited by guarantee registered in England & Wales no 09826787 and its registered office is at 2nd Floor Goldings House, Hay’s Galleria, 2 Hay’s Lane, London, SE1 2HB.

Office of Health Economics (OHE)

The purpose of the Office of Health Economics (OHE) is to advance the education of the public in general/health care payers/policy makers (and particularly patients and healthcare professionals) on the subject of health economics and healthcare policy.

The OHE is a company limited by guarantee registered in England and Wales (registered number 09848965) and its registered office is at 2nd Floor Goldings House, Hay’s Galleria, 2 Hay’s Lane, London, SE1 2HB.
